## v3.8.0 — Setting renamed

The Sproutline watering scheduler setting `SPROUT_CRON_WINDOW` has been renamed to `SPROUT_SCHEDULE_WINDOW` for consistency with the irrigation module. The old name still works but logs a deprecation warning and will be removed in v4.0. Migration is a straight rename; values and units are unchanged. Note that the scheduler now also requires an authenticated session with the Sproutline hub, configured via the environment file. Add the following entry directly below your schedule settings.

env line for fafof-fahag: LEDGER_TOKEN5=f8790

Grindle sidecar ships metrics from each pod to the Coalhouse aggregator. Restart order: sidecar first, app second. Config lives in .env next to the binary. Set AGG_ENDPOINT to the regional collector and FLUSH_INTERVAL=10s. Missing metrics usually means a stale endpoint; check the region map. Never run two sidecars per pod. Put the aggregator auth secret on the following line of .env.

sealed setting: RELAY_SECRET5=82864

Escalation: Consent banner (Project Thorngate) is at 40% rollout. If opt-out rates exceed 15% in any region, or the banner fails to render on legacy Kestrelview clients, halt the ramp via the flags console. Legal sign-off is required before any copy change, no exceptions. Capture screenshots and region data before rolling back. For halts or legal escalation outside business hours, use the address below.

escalation mailbox, bafog-fafog: ulador@paliqlabs.internal

Welcome to the Lanterbee donations team. The receipt mailer runs every fifteen minutes and sends PDF donation receipts for any gift recorded in the Quillhaven ledger. If the queue backs up, check the mailer pod logs first — most stalls are caused by a malformed donor record, not the mailer itself. Retries are safe; receipts are idempotent by gift ID. Before restarting the worker locally, copy env.sample to .env and fill in the standard values. Then add the mailer's signing credential on the next line:

sealed setting: ARCHIVE_KEY3=8d0